Carbon Steel: Properties, Production, Examples and Applications
Carbon steel is an iron-carbon alloy, which contains up to 2.1 wt.% carbon. For carbon steels, there is no minimum specified content of other alloying elements, however, they often contain manganese. The maximum manganese, silicon and copper content should be less than 1.65 wt.%, 0.6 wt.% and 0.6 wt.%, respectively.
Types of carbon steel and their properties
Carbon steel can be classified into three categories according to its carbon content: low-carbon steel (or mild-carbon steel), medium-carbon steel and high-carbon steel . Their carbon content, microstructure and properties compare as follows:
| Carbon content (wt.%) | Microstructure | Properties | Examples | 
| Low-carbon steel | < 0.25 | Ferrite, pearlite | Low hardness and cost. High ductility, toughness, machinability and weldability | 
| Medium-carbon steel | 0.25 – 0.60 | Martensite | Low hardenability, medium strength, ductility and toughness | 
| High-carbon steel | 0.60 – 1.25 | Pearlite | High hardness, strength, low ductility |

| A572 | C | Mn | P | S | Si | 
| Grade42 | 0.21 | 1.35 | 0.03 | 0.03 | 0.15~0.4 | 
| Grade50 | 0.23 | 1.35 | 0.03 | 0.03 | 0.15~0.4 | 
| Grade60 | 0.26 | 1.35 | 0.03 | 0.03 | 0.4 | 
| Grade65 | 0.23~0.26 | 1.35~1.65 | 0.03 | 0.03 | 0.4 | 
| A572 | Yield Strength(Ksi) | Tensile
  Strength(Ksi) | Elongation % 8inches | 
| Grade42 | 42 | 60 | 20 | 
| Grade50 | 50 | 65 | 18 | 
| Grade60 | 60 | 75 | 16 | 
| Grade65 | 65 | 80 | 15 |
